    Household Batteries: Lithium-ion, Lead-acid, and Beyond

    The household battery segment in China offers diverse technologies to meet various application requirements. Lithium-ion batteries dominate the premium segment, with options including:

    • Lithium Iron Phosphate (LFP): Known for exceptional safety and long cycle life (typically 3,000-6,000 cycles)
    • Nickel Manganese Cobalt (NMC): Offering higher energy density but slightly reduced cycle life
    • Lithium Titanate Oxide (LTO): Providing extreme fast-charging capabilities and exceptional lifespan

    Lead-acid batteries continue to serve cost-sensitive applications, with advanced AGM and gel variants offering maintenance-free operation. Emerging technologies like sodium-ion batteries are gaining traction for stationary storage applications where cost per cycle is paramount. The household battery market has seen particularly strong growth in backup power solutions, with Hong Kong households showing a 42% increase in adoption rates between 2021-2023 according to the Hong Kong Energy Bureau. This growth has been driven by increasing power stability concerns and the rising adoption of solar energy systems.

    Stackable ESS Solutions: Modular Design and Scalability

    Stackable Energy Storage Systems (ESS) represent one of the most significant innovations in the battery industry, and Chinese manufacturers have pioneered their development. These systems allow users to start with a base configuration and expand capacity as needed by simply adding additional modules. The key advantage lies in their modular architecture, which typically includes:

    Component Function Scalability Impact
    Battery Modules Energy storage units Capacity expansion through additional modules
    Battery Management System Monitoring and protection Designed to accommodate expanded capacity
    Power Conversion System DC-AC conversion Often scalable through parallel operation

    Customization Options: Voltage, Capacity, Size

    Chinese battery manufacturers offer extensive customization capabilities that allow international buyers to develop tailored solutions for specific market requirements. The primary customization parameters include:

    Parameter Typical Range Application Considerations
    Voltage 12V-800V Determined by application requirements and compatibility with existing systems
    Capacity 1kWh-1MWh+ Based on energy storage needs and available space
    Physical Dimensions Fully customizable Optimized for installation environment and transportation constraints
    Communication Protocols CAN, RS485, Modbus, Bluetooth, WiFi Ensuring compatibility with existing monitoring and control systems

    Due Diligence: Verifying Certifications and Business Licenses

    Comprehensive due diligence is essential when selecting Chinese battery suppliers to mitigate risks and ensure product quality. The verification process should extend beyond basic business registration to include technical certifications and manufacturing capabilities assessment. Critical certifications for battery products include:

    Certification Scope Importance
    UN38.3 Transportation safety Mandatory for international shipping of lithium batteries
    IEC 62619 Safety standards for industrial batteries Essential for energy storage systems
    CE Mark European compliance Required for marketing in European Economic Area
    UL 1973 Stationary storage safety Important for North American markets

    Beyond certifications, verification should include factory audits, either conducted in person or through third-party services. These audits assess manufacturing processes, quality control systems, and working conditions. Additional checks should include financial stability assessment through credit reporting services and verification of export experience through shipping records.     Minimum Order Quantities

    Minimum Order Quantities represent a critical consideration when sourcing from Chinese battery manufacturers, directly impacting pricing and production scheduling. MOQs vary significantly based on product type and customization level:

    Product Category Typical MOQ Factors Influencing MOQ
    Standard household batteries 500-2,000 units Higher for basic models, lower for premium products
    Stackable ESS modules 50-200 units Varies with system complexity and battery chemistry
    Custom wall-mounted systems 100-500 units Higher for fully custom designs, lower for modified standards
    Completely custom solutions 1,000+ units Dependent on development cost recovery requirements

    Negotiating MOQs requires understanding the manufacturer's constraints.     Payment Terms and Currency Exchange

    Payment terms represent a crucial aspect of international sourcing that requires careful negotiation and risk management. Chinese suppliers typically offer tiered payment terms based on order value, relationship history, and perceived risk. Common payment structures include:

    • T/T (Telegraphic Transfer): 30% deposit with balance before shipment - most common for new relationships
    • L/C (Letter of Credit): Provides security for both parties but involves banking fees
    • Western Union: Used for small sample payments despite higher fees
    • Alibaba Trade Assurance: Offers protection through escrow with release upon satisfactory delivery

    Currency exchange risk management is particularly important given potential fluctuations between major currencies and the Chinese Yuan. Strategies include forward contracts to lock in exchange rates and multi-currency accounts that reduce conversion costs. According to Hong Kong Banking Association data, businesses that actively manage currency risk achieve 3-7% better sourcing costs compared to those that don't.     Shipping and Logistics

    Efficient logistics management is essential for successful battery sourcing from China, complicated by the classification of lithium batteries as dangerous goods. Shipping options include:

    • Air freight: Fast but expensive, with strict quantity limitations for lithium batteries
    • Sea freight: Most cost-effective for full container loads but with longer transit times
    • Express couriers: Suitable for samples and small quantities despite regulatory complexities

    The regulatory landscape for battery shipping requires careful attention to documentation, packaging, and labeling requirements. Section IB of the IATA Dangerous Goods Regulations specifies packaging standards and quantity limits for air transport. Sea freight requires compliance with IMDG Code classifications and proper documentation. Working with experienced freight forwarders who specialize in battery shipments is crucial.     Quality Control and Inspection

    Implementing robust quality control processes is non-negotiable when sourcing batteries from China, given the safety implications and performance expectations. A comprehensive quality assurance program should include:

    Inspection Stage Focus Areas Methods
    Pre-production Raw material verification, process validation Supplier audits, material certification review
    During Production Process control, intermediate testing In-line testing, statistical process control
    Pre-shipment Finished product verification, safety compliance AQL sampling, performance testing, safety certification check
    Loading Supervision Packaging integrity, labeling accuracy Container inspection, loading process observation

    Material Selection and Sourcing

    Material selection significantly impacts battery performance, safety, and cost structure. Chinese manufacturers offer various options across key components:

    Component Material Options Performance Implications
    Cathode LFP, NMC, LCO, LMO Energy density, cycle life, cost, safety characteristics
    Anode Graphite, LTO, Silicon-composite Charge rate, cycle life, energy density
    Separator PE, PP, Ceramic-coated Safety performance, ionic conductivity
    Electrolyte Liquid, Polymer, Solid-state Operating temperature range, safety, performance

    Material sourcing strategy should consider supply chain stability, cost fluctuations, and quality consistency.     Manufacturing Process: From Prototyping to Mass Production

    The transition from prototype to mass production represents a critical phase in battery development that requires careful management to maintain product quality while achieving cost targets. The manufacturing process typically involves:

    • Cell manufacturing: Electrode preparation, cell assembly, formation, and aging
    • Module assembly: Cell sorting, interconnection, integration with BMS, and enclosure
    • System integration: Combining modules with power conversion, control systems, and safety components
    • Testing and validation: Performance verification, safety testing, and quality assurance
